foff667
10-08-2006, 10:47 PM
you will run out of injector with those racetronics injectors if you go FI, but if you go big NA theres a strong possibility you'll run into tuning issues from what I hear with the stock pcm. Personally I've never done anything larger then the racetronics 42lbers but I hear all kinda issues once you go much larger. Also consider the racetronics injectors you speak of are rated at 43.5psi...whereas LS1's have a stock FP of 58psi meaning those 42lbers are actually more like 50lb injectors.
